Output 8d34032e0026ea43268a3e7bf605a6cbbfd7ffd61f7dccb276b63a3037d58df7:23

value
68378842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308e126b1c5bb5454fe022158d8da5bf547d6a8e OP_EQUAL
address
MCKtryDF8LR3p2FP6SDGTbjZdaQDK2gmya
transaction
8d34032e0026ea43268a3e7bf605a6cbbfd7ffd61f7dccb276b63a3037d58df7
spent
true